Steps:
- Mix together all ingredients except raspberries in a large saucepan.
- Cover and bring to boil.
- Uncover and boil gently about 25 minutes or until thickened, stirring occasionally.
- Add the thawed raspberries to the chutney, stirring lightly.
- Return to boil and boil gently 4 minutes longer, without stirring, or until slightly thickened.
- Pour hot chutney into sterilized jars and refrigerate for up to 2 weeks or can using USDA canning guidelines for longer storage.
